Fi router e Avoid using Wi Fi channel which is overlapped by the nearby Wi Fi network e Check if your network speed is fast enough in cases where multiple devices share the same router the wireless performance may be affected Turn off the other devices connected to your home router e Enable the Quality of Service QoS option if available on the Wi Fi router e Turn off other Wi Fi routers Music streaming failed with PC Mac e Temporarily disable the firewall and security software to see whether it blocks the ports that the media sharing software Media Manager uses to stream content See the help documentation of your firewall and security software on how to unblock the ports used by wireless media sharing e When you use iPod Touch iPhone iPad PC Mac for music streaming if the music play breaks or stops try to restart your IPod Touch iPhone iPad media sharing software or AW5000 e Video streaming or FTP downloads may overload your router and therefore may cause Interruptions during music streaming Try to reduce the load of your router The power status indicator remains red What can do e You need to recover the device with an Ethernet cable 1 Make sure that your router is connected to the Internet 2 Connect the device to the router through an Ethernet cable 3 Wait for automatic recovery of the device which may take up to 10 minutes EN 27 9 Appendix 1 Mount the device onto wall Ca

22. s To keep the warranty valid never try to repair the system yourself If you encounter problems when using this apparatus check the following points before requesting service If the problem remains unsolved go to the Philips web site www philips com welcome When you contact Philips ensure that the apparatus is nearby and the model number and serial number are available No power e Make sure that the AC power plug of the device is connected properly e Make sure that there is power at the AC outlet e Check whether the device is in Eco standby mode No sound e Check whether the device is muted The power status indicator flashes white when the device is muted Adjust volume on the Philips AirStudio app or on AVWV5000 directly e If you have chosen the wired connection check whether the Ethernet cable has been connected properly and securely e Check the Wi Fi network connection Set up the network again if needed see Connect AVWV5000 to your home Wi Fi network on page 9 e If the audio source is an external audio player adjust volume on the audio player directly No response from the device e Restart AW5000 and then set up the Wi Fi network for AVV5000 again e Disconnect and reconnect the AC power plug and then switch on the device again 26 EN Wi Fi network connection failed e This device does not support the WPS PIN method e Enable SSID broadcast on the Wi Fi router
